Question
Solve the equations x + y = 4 and 2x - y = 5 using the method of reduction.
Solution
The given equations can be considered in the matrix equation as
AX = B
i.e `[(1,1), (2,-1)] [(x), (y)] = [(4),(5)]`
Apply R2 - 2R1
`[(1,1), (0,-3)] [(x),(y)] = [(4),(-3)]`
`[(x + y), (-3y)] = [(4),(-3)]`
By equality of matrices
x + y = 4, -3y = -3
x = 3 y = 1
